When should you rush to an emergency dental clinic NYC?

It is a waste of time, money and energy if you go to your dentist for every little thing. It can also be very stressful. At the same time if you neglect a real dental emergency and don’t see a dentist in time then you will unnecessarily complicate and worsen the situation at hand.

Then when should you go to an emergency dental clinic? Or rather how do you recognize a dental emergency at hand? We have listed some situations below that would warrant getting professional help immediately:

  • A broken or knocked out tooth
  • Bleeding that won’t stop
  • Damaged or lost restoration
  • Unusual swelling in and around the mouth
  • Gum infection with pain or swelling
  • Severe pain in the tooth, teeth or jaw bone
  • Dental abscess
  • Numb tooth
  • Loose adult tooth
  • Heightened tooth sensitivity

The list above is not exhaustive because in some situations it won’t be clear whether it constitutes a dental emergency as many situations are gray and not stark black and white. That’s why we recommend calling your dentist for a dental consultation when you are unsure about what to do.

Why go to a dentist for an emergency instead of the emergency room?

Emergency dentistry is a specialized field and most emergency rooms do not have dentists or the equipment required to treat a dental emergency. So, if you end up at an emergency room for tooth problems they can only provide you with painkillers and antibiotics and will redirect you to an emergency dental care.

To get the right treatment you will need to visit the dentist. At the end of the day you will end up with two bills one from the emergency room and the other one from your dentist if you visit the emergency room for a dental emergency. By going to the dentist you can get the right treatment in the first instance itself.

Benefits of emergency dental care

The main focus of any emergency dental treatment is to relieve you of your mouth pain quickly and effectively. It also prevents your dental trauma from turning into an extensive issue requiring harsher treatments.

By immediately visiting the emergency dentist you can drastically improve your oral health. There are many types of emergency dental treatments available and the emergency dentist will first examine the problem, diagnose and then decide on the most effective course of treatment.

From treating the infection, removing the infected tooth to replacing missing tooth fragments, emergency dentists can perform many important operations and prescribe pain medications and antibiotics as well.

How to avoid a dental emergency?

The causes behind a dental emergency can be avoided if you have good oral hygiene  and practice good dental habits. We have listed some of the things you can do to boost your oral health below:

  • Brush your teeth twice a day
  • Floss daily
  • Eat a balanced diet
  • Avoid smoking and consuming tobacco 
  • Visit your dentist regularly
  • Get a teeth cleaning every 6 months
  • Don’t use your teeth to open bottles or packages for that matter
  • Don’t chew on hard foods or items
  • Wear a mouth guard while playing sports especially contact sports
